The One-Step Smokey ft. Shiro Cosmetics


As you may all know by now, my favourite way of doing my makeup as of late is with an effortless one-product, slightly smokey but defined eye. And my favourite eyeshadow shades to use for this endeavor? Taupes. I just love me some taupes. My number one favourite product for this look is a very dirty and cruel Rimmel kohl pencil. However, I've finally found a perfect natural and vegan alternative. A gorgeous pigment by Shiro Cosmetics called Hodor. It's pretty much the eyeshadow version of the Rimmel pencil with a 10x better ingredients list and a 100x better name. Yes, it's Game of Thrones inspired (if the artwork on the lid didn't give it away already!).

I would describe the shade as a cool-toned true taupe with slight silver shimmer which doesn't really appear on the lids. I just take a fluffy eyeshadow brush, dip the tip in the pot, tap off any excess and get to work. This method allows for application and blending in just a couple seconds. Add a few lashings of mascara and what you get is a look that instantly looks a little more put-together. If you're more of a warm-toned kind of gal, I would suggest No Men Like Me from the same GoT collection. It's a very similar shade but this one has a beautiful golden bronze sheen to it that is really flattering on my brown eyes. I'd also suspect that it'd look stunning on the blue-eyed of us.
